​Guinea-Bissau: Ilídio Vieira is appointed Prime Minister and Minister of Finance 

  While the junta that seized power in Guinea-Bissau appointed last Thursday General Horta N’Tam as transitional president, Umaro Sissoco Embaló signed from the coast of Senegal to take refuge there, Ilídio Vieira Té is now the new Prime Minister of Guinea-Bissau. In addition to directing the government, Vieira Té cumule également le portefeuille des Finances, assuming the political and economic management of the country for a period of 12 mois.
